Everytime i add in my footage it comes in small and when i try to zoom in it has low. res

According to the Info to the Right of the thumbnail for the footage in the Project Panel, your footage is a 360 X 640 H.264 MP4, and that is awfully small. It looks like your comp is probably a vertical standard HD 1080 X 1920. You are going to either have to find a higher resolution copy of the footage or record one or scale up the footage 300% and live with the artifacts.
If your only option is to scale up the footage try using the Detail-Preserving-Upscale effect. It will offer some improvement but it cannot work miracles.

Ive tried what you said and it turned out that the problem was that on my recording software, the output (scaled) resolution was the one that was 640x360. I changed it and i no longer have that problem, Thank you for your help.
